Introduction
The Newman-Vollmar House is located on US 421 in Osgood, Indiana, a small town in the southeastern corner of the state less than thirty (30) minutes from Ohio and Kentucky. This location provides easy access to antiques and many other interesting activities.

The home was built for the leading hardware operator of the day. Much of the original flare still survives, including original oak woodwork, fireplace mantels and stained glass windows.

The Newman-Vollmar House was voted "Best B & B for Room Amenities" in Arrington's 2005 Inn Traveler Book of Lists and Voted 14th "Best Breakfast" in the Midwest in their 2006 Book of Lists.

Our location provides easy access to many interesting activities...

Historic Madison · Milan · Friendship · Batesville

  • The Versailles State Park, Indiana's 2nd largest, is just five (5) minutes away. On the way to the park make sure you take time to see one of the few remaining outdoor theaters in the state. Enjoy the approximately 10 miles of mountain bike trails, opening April 27, 2006.
  • Another destination that may interest you is Historic Madison, Indiana, a twenty-six (26) mile trip, which is host to an annual speedboat competition during the July 4th weekend.
  • Milan, home of the 1954 State basketball champions, only ten (10) miles from Osgood, features not only several antique stores and Milan Museum, but also Equine Massage Classes Many continue their day trip by going to the riverboat casinos either in Rising Sun or Lawrenceburg, which are within a thirty (30) minute drive.
  • Other short drives are Friendship and Batesville. Every Spring and Fall is the Friendship Flea Market and National Muzzle Loading Rifle Shoot. In Batesville, there is the Weberding's Carving Shop where you may visit the unique custom woodworking facility. There are also some covered bridges in the county that are worth a visit as well.
  • Other annual events include the Ripley County Fair (summer), Apple Harvest Festival (fall), The Versailles Pumpkin Festival (fall), Blue Grass Festival (fall).
